Full job description
Overview
We are seeking an enthusiastic, experienced, and highly capable Front of House Manager to lead our vibrant hospitality team. This pivotal role ensures a seamless dining experience for our guests while maintaining exceptional standards of service, presentation, and operational efficiency.
The ideal candidate will bring strong leadership, a genuine passion for customer satisfaction, and a commitment to delivering memorable guest experiences. A solid understanding of food and wine service, combined with the ability to inspire and develop a team, is essential.
Key Responsibilities / Duties
- Lead and oversee the day-to-day front of house operations, ensuring service standards are consistently delivered at a high level.
- Plan, prepare, and manage staff rotas, ensuring appropriate coverage in line with business needs, seasonal demand, and budgeted labour targets.
- Recruit, train, and develop front of house staff, fostering a positive, motivated, and high-performing team culture.
- Instil a strong customer-first mindset across the team, ensuring every guest receives a warm welcome and outstanding service.
- Conduct regular team briefings, performance reviews, and ongoing coaching.
- Ensure excellent communication and collaboration between front of house and kitchen teams.
- Deliver exceptional customer service by managing guest interactions, resolving complaints professionally, and consistently striving to exceed customer expectations.
- Maintain a strong presence on the floor during service, leading by example and actively engaging with guests.
- Oversee reservations, table management, and service flow to maximise guest satisfaction and revenue.
- Manage stock control for beverages and front of house supplies, including ordering and supplier liaison.
- Drive upselling opportunities, particularly within wine and beverage offerings, enhancing the overall guest experience.
- Ensure compliance with all health & safety, licensing, and hygiene regulations.
- Monitor financial performance, including labour costs, wastage, and sales targets.
Wine Knowledge & Experience (Essential/Desirable)
- Solid understanding of wine varieties, regions, and styles (e.g. Old World vs New World wines).
- Ability to confidently recommend wine pairings to complement menu items and enhance customer satisfaction.
- Experience managing or contributing to a wine list, including pricing and supplier selection.
- Knowledge of wine service standards, including correct glassware, storage, and presentation.
- Confidence in training staff on wine knowledge and upselling techniques to improve the guest experience.
- Formal wine qualification (e.g. WSET Level 2 or above) is highly desirable but not essential.
Skills & Experience
- Proven experience in a Front of House Manager or senior supervisory role within hospitality.
- Strong leadership and people management skills, with the ability to motivate and inspire teams.
- Excellent organisational skills, including rota planning and labour management.
- A clear passion for delivering exceptional customer service and continuously improving the guest experience.
- Strong commercial awareness with experience managing budgets and driving revenue.
- Experience in bartending and beverage service, including wines and cocktails.
- Good understanding of food and culinary operations.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Ability to remain calm under pressure in a fast-paced environment.
- Strong attention to detail and commitment to maintaining high standards.
Personal Attributes
- Passionate about hospitality, with a genuine drive to deliver outstanding customer satisfaction.
- A hands-on leader who leads by example and takes pride in service delivery.
- Positive, proactive, and solutions-focused.
- Strong team player with the ability to build rapport with staff and guests alike.
- Flexible and adaptable approach to working hours.
